How to measure wheel stud thread?


You can use a thread pitch gauge to determine the number of threads per inch or the distance between threads in metric connections. Place the gauge on the threads until the fit is snug.



What size are wheel stud threads?


The thread size or thread diameter is the measurement taken across the outside diameter of your wheel stud threads measured in either standard (7/16″, 1/2″, etc.) or metric (12mm, 14mm, etc.) dimensions. The most common thread sizes are 10mm, 12mm, 14mm, 7/16″, 1/2″, 9/16″, 5/8″.



How do I know my stud size?


To find the stud size just measure the diameter of the shank. The shank is the shaft-like part of the bolt or stud. Preferably use calipers to obtain an accurate measure of the shank's diameter, but a ruler works too. In most automotive instances, the shank's diameter is going to be either 1/4, 5/16, or 3/8.
